  • ERP Specialist (IFS Cloud Experience)  

    - Los Angeles
    Description: Signia Aerospace is a global, integrated provider of high... Read More
    Description:

    Signia Aerospace is a global, integrated provider of high-performance systems and specialized components for the aerospace industry. Signia designs, manufactures, and services a wide range of products, that include mission equipment, thermal management systems, engine technology, and propellers. The Signia brands are leaders in their respective markets and provide a compelling value proposition to both aerospace and defense OEMs and end-users.


    Onboard Systems Hoist & Winch, located in Anaheim, CA is one of the world's leading providers of Search & Rescue (SAR) and Human External Cargo (HEC) advanced mission equipment for civil, commercial, and military helicopters.


    Position Overview


    Location: Anaheim, CA

    Schedule: Monday - Friday

    Pay: $100,000 - $120,000 per year


    The ERP Specialist is responsible for the strategic design, configuration, administration, and optimization of the IFS Cloud ERP environment. A particular focus will be on manufacturing and supply chain functions, including the Material Requirements Planning (MRP) module.


    What You'll Do

    Drive requirements gathering with business stakeholders to design robust solutions across modules such as Finance, Supply Chain, Inventory Management, Manufacturing, and Warehousing.Evaluate, recommend, and implement capabilities, features, and enhancements to support business growth and process improvements.Manage IFS integrations with third-party applications including PLM.Develop and maintain technical documentation, including system configurations, workflows, and data mappings.Manage day-to-day operations of the IFS Cloud environment, including user account management, permissions, and security roles.Partner with other Signia Aerospace ERP specialists to apply lessons learned across ERP environments.Provide support to business units in investigating unexpected outputs with underlying log data and reports. Collaborate with the system implementer (vendor) on advanced customizations and large-scale implementations. Support reporting and business analytics.


    Who You Are

    3+ years of experience implementing, administering, or serving as a Subject Matter Expert (SME) for large ERP platforms (preferably IFS Cloud) in the manufacturing industry. Proven experience in both solution architecture and system administration roles for ERP platforms.Strong background in ERP integrations, particularly with PLM.Experience with custom report generation through SQL queries and other data analytics tools.


    What's In It for You

    Benefits package including medical, dental, vision, life, disabilityPaid time off and holidays 401(k) plan with employer contribution matchingIn addition to offering competitive wages and benefits, Onboard Systems also offers the opportunity to increase your future earnings tied to growth in company performance. We recognize employee contributions toward growing the business through our unique Growth Participation Unit program (GPU). GPUs are tied directly to company growth and reward all eligible employees with cash when the business grows over time.

  • Safety Management System Coordinator  

    - Irvine
    Description: Signia Aerospace is a global, integrated provider of high... Read More
    Description:

    Signia Aerospace is a global, integrated provider of high-performance systems and specialized components for the aerospace industry. Signia designs, manufactures, and services a wide range of products, that include mission equipment, thermal management systems, engine technology, and propellers. The Signia brands are leaders in their respective markets and provide a compelling value proposition to both aerospace and defense OEMs and end-users.


    Onboard Systems Hoist & Winch, located in Anaheim, CA is one of the world's leading providers of Search & Rescue (SAR) and Human External Cargo (HEC) advanced mission equipment for civil, commercial, and military helicopters.


    Position Overview


    Location: Anaheim, CA (On-site)

    Schedule: Monday - Friday

    Pay: $75,000 - $85,000 per year


    The Safety Management System (SMS) Coordinator is responsible for maintaining and administering the company's SMS program while ensuring compliance with aviation safety regulations, including FAA Part 5 requirements. This role coordinates safety initiatives, analyzes safety data, and provides reporting on overall safety performance to support continuous improvement. Working closely with leadership, the SMS Coordinator helps promote a proactive safety culture and ensures the safety of employees, processes, and products.


    What You'll Do

    Administer and maintain the company Safety Management System (SMS) in compliance with FAA Part 5 and other applicable regulatory requirements.Advise leadership on safety-related matters and support the development of a proactive safety culture throughout the organization.Manage the company safety reporting process, including the collection, analysis, trending, and reporting of safety data and key performance indicators.Conduct safety audits, inspections, and risk assessments, recommending corrective and preventive actions as needed.Investigate incidents and safety occurrences, prepare reports, and drive actions to prevent recurrence.Serve as the primary liaison with aviation regulatory authorities and external safety organizations, including the FAA, EASA, UK CAA, and CAAC.Develop, maintain, and coordinate the company Emergency Response Plan.Lead safety review meetings, support EHS initiatives, and provide regular safety performance updates to management.Partner with Quality and Operations teams to ensure safety requirements are effectively integrated into company processes and programs.


    Who You Are

    Safety Management System (SMS) certification and experience in an aviation, aerospace, or other safety-sensitive environment; equivalent experience may be considered.Minimum of two years of progressive experience in Safety Management, Safety Engineering, Quality, Compliance, or a related field.Internal Auditor certification or demonstrated experience conducting audits, maintaining records, and preparing compliance reports.Knowledge of Safety Management Systems (SMS), aviation safety principles, and human factors.Working knowledge of applicable regulations, including FAA regulations, OSHA requirements, and labor code compliance.Experience with ISO 9001 or other recognized quality management systems.


    Preferred Skills

    Strong organizational, time management, and project coordination skills.Excellent written, verbal, interviewing, and presentation skills.Ability to handle sensitive and confidential information with discretion.Strong analytical, administrative, and reporting capabilities.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ications, including Excel, Word, PowerPoint, and Outlook.Ability to work independently while effectively collaborating across departments and leadership teams.


    What's In It for You

    Benefits package including medical, dental, vision, life, disabilityPaid time off and holidays 401(k) plan with employer contribution matchingIn addition to offering competitive wages and benefits, Onboard Systems also offers the opportunity to increase your future earnings tied to growth in company performance. We recognize employee contributions toward growing the business through our unique Growth Participation Unit program (GPU). GPUs are tied directly to company growth and reward all eligible employees with cash when the business grows over time.

  • Configuration Management Manager  

    - Anaheim
    Description: Signia Aerospace is a global, integrated provider of high... Read More
    Description:

    Signia Aerospace is a global, integrated provider of high-performance systems and specialized components for the aerospace industry. Signia designs, manufactures, and services a wide range of products, that include mission equipment, thermal management systems, engine technology, and propellers. The Signia brands are leaders in their respective markets and provide a compelling value proposition to both aerospace and defense OEMs and end-users.


    Onboard Systems Hoist & Winch, located in Anaheim, CA is one of the world's leading providers of Search & Rescue (SAR) and Human External Cargo (HEC) advanced mission equipment for civil, commercial, and military helicopters.


    Position Overview


    Location: Anaheim, CA (On-site)

    Schedule: Monday - Friday

    Pay: $130,000 - $140,000 per year


    The Configuration Management Manager leads the configuration management function and oversees the Drafting and Engineering Services teams supporting engineering and product development activities. This role manages configuration data within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) systems and their integration with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) systems to ensure data integrity, configuration control, and effective collaboration across engineering, manufacturing, supply chain, and quality teams.


    The position supports product lifecycle activities across a wide range of systems and configurations-from creation through obsolescence-including hardware, software, firmware, COTS, development, test, production, and fielded baselines.


    This role ensures configuration control and compliance with Quality Management System (QMS), technical, regulatory, and company requirements. The manager identifies and resolves data anomalies, applies analytical problem-solving, and communicates complex processes effectively in both verbal and written formats. Additionally, the role supports PLM administration and business initiatives, partnering with IT and engineering teams to enhance system workflows and improve data accuracy.


    What You'll Do

    Configuration Management Leadership - Establish and maintain configuration management policies, processes, and standards across the organization.Engineering Change Management - Manage the Engineering Change Request (CR) and Change Order (CO) process.Drafting and Engineering Services Management - Lead and manage the Drafting team responsible for engineering drawings, CAD documentation, and revisions. Ensure drafting standards, drawing quality, and documentation compliance. Provide engineering services support for product documentation, BOM management, and technical documentation. Understanding of ASME Y14.100 and ASME Y14.5M -1994 or later).Process Improvement - Identify opportunities to improve configuration management, documentation workflows, and engineering services processes. Develop metrics and reporting for configuration control, change management, and documentation accuracy.Team Leadership - Manage and mentor drafting and engineering services staff. Set team goals, performance metrics, and development plans.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ure accurate and timely configuration updates.Execute/support configuration audits and reviews to ensure adherence to policy, plans and applicable standards.

    Who You Are

    Bachelor's degree in engineering, Engineering Technology, or related technical field.7-10+ years of experience in configuration management, engineering documentation, or product data management.3-5+ years of leadership or supervisory experience.Experience with PLM systems (e.g., Siemens Teamcenter, Dassault ENOVIA, or similar).Strong understanding of engineering change management processes (ECR/ECO).Experience managing CAD drawing control and BOM structures.Must be able to read and interpret procedures required to meet the contractual requirements of the programs assigned.Proficient with MS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oints, PDF editors)Excellent verbal and written communication skills including ability to work on a teamConfiguration and product data managementPLM and ERP system expertiseEngineering change controlProcess improvement and documentation controlStrong analytical and organizational skills
